🎧 Day 22 – Finishing the Race with JoySeries: Sealing the Month in Prayer Podcast: Daily Prayer with Natanael CosteaEpisode FocusDay 22 resolves endurance with joy, teaching that joy is not a reward at the end of obedience but a companion throughout the journey. This episode helps listeners rediscover joy as spiritual strength and sustain faithfulness with gladness.Key ScripturesNehemiah 8:10 – The joy of the Lord is your strength.Hebrews 12:2 – Jesus endured the cross for the joy set before Him.Key Teaching PointsJoy is a source of strength, not the result of strength.Endurance without joy leads to heaviness; endurance with joy sustains faith.Jesus modelled joyful endurance by fixing His eyes on what was ahead.The enemy seeks to steal joy when he cannot stop obedience.God invites believers to finish their race full, not depleted.Memorable Sayings & Anchors“Joy is a companion in obedience, not a reward at the end.”“If the enemy cannot stop your obedience, he will try to steal your joy.”“Joy is the serious business of heaven.” — C.S. Lewis“Endurance becomes lighter when joy walks alongside faithfulness.”Reflective QuestionsAm I enduring with God or merely enduring for God?Has joy accompanied my obedience, or has it been lost along the way?What would it look like to finish faithfully and joyfully?Prayer EmphasisReceiving renewed joy as spiritual strengthReleasing heaviness and joyless enduranceRestoring gladness in obedience and faithfulnessFinishing God’s assignment with a full heartStrengthening faith through joyful trustListener TakeawayJoy is not optional for endurance; it is essential. When joy is restored, faithfulness becomes lighter and the race can be finished with strength and gladness.
